Description –
As a Performance Test Engineer, you will play a key role in an activity that will, from a quality assurance view, support delivery of a new and exciting platform used to improve healthcare worldwide. You should possess a self-starter and can-do attitude, and have the desire to deliver high performant, exciting software products. The aim is to play a key role in delivering a high quality, world-class software platform.
Responsibilities –
- Investigate and document all performance requirements, including non-functional requirements and environment, tool and test data needs.
- Select and implement a performance testing tool
- Work with architecture, product owners, and development teams to ensure a thorough understanding of the applications under test
- Build out all system and component level performance tests.
- Build re-usable performance test capabilities.
- Advise on and build solutions for all performance testing needs (example: Performance, Stress, Soak etc)
- Develop tests aligned with tight timelines
- Execute performance tests
- Create reports based on performance test executions designed for stakeholders at all levels
- Work with development teams to integrate performance tests with the CI/CD pipelines
